A more gentle walk for those with a medical condition that means their mobility is limited, and who feel their fitness levels have declined as a result. Reduced balance may also be an issue. The challenge is still to manage an hour walk, with rests when needed. Exercises are included to work on leg strength, flexibility and balance. Regularly weekly walks can bring about improvements, and improve confidence. The walk will cover different routes each week on the Greensward, or inland along the wooded paths. A comfortably paced walk for you to enjoy in a social atmosphere, the qualified Exercise Referral Instructor will lead you through a warm up, a short walk making stops along the way if needed and working on posture. Exercise bands are often used to give the legs a rest if required to work on the upper body. A sociable enjoyable session finishing with a stretch and then if the weather is dry a cuppa in the park.
Poles are provided.

This walk along the North Devon coast includes a section of the South West Coast National Trail. The route follows paths and lanes enjoying spectacular views along the Atlantic coastline accompanied by possible sightings of porpoise and seals.
We start and finish at the meeting point where outstanding views of the local coastline await our return in a smart and contemporary venue (The Pier House).
